Ingredients
Steps
-
Prepare materials
-
Wash the lamb chops and prick them with toothpicks so that they can be more flavorful when marinating;
-
Add an appropriate amount of ginger slices, corn oil, light soy sauce, oyster sauce, chili powder, black pepper powder, and cumin powder to the lamb chops. Mix evenly and massage for a few minutes;
-
Cover the lamb chops with plastic wrap and refrigerate overnight;
-
Put a piece of tin foil on a baking sheet, cover it with another piece of tin foil, and put the marinated lamb chops on it;
-
Put into the preheated Westinghouse WTO-PC2801 oven, select the steam baking mode, heat up and down to 190 degrees, middle layer, time for 50 minutes; after the time is up, open the tin foil and bake for another 30 minutes
-
The roasted lamb chops are out of the oven. Cut them into pieces and eat.
